According to data records, the highest incidence of the Qani surname is found in Somalia, with a total of 1225 recorded instances. This indicates that the surname is relatively more common in Somalia compared to other countries where it is also present.
In Morocco, the Qani surname has an incidence of 273, followed by Indonesia with 198, Iran with 120, and Afghanistan with 41. Other countries where the Qani surname is present include Albania, the United States, Pakistan, Azerbaijan, Yemen, Canada, Ethiopia, Malaysia, Tunisia, Sweden, South Africa, Denmark, India, Iraq, Jordan, Kenya, Niger, Syria, Thailand, and Uganda, with varying incidence rates.
